Before purchasing new pallets, organizations ought to consider numerous factors that can considerably affect their choice:

Load Capacity: Analyze the weight of the products you mean to carry and make sure the pallets can deal with the load.

Pallet Size: Standard sizes are generally 48"x40", but organizations may require custom-made sizes depending on their requirements.

Material: Determine the best material based upon the specific usage case-- examine the environment and product nature.

Toughness Requirements: Consider how often pallets will be reused and the conditions they will deal with, such as exposure to moisture or chemicals.

Regulative Compliance: Some markets need pallets to satisfy specific policies (e.g., ISPM 15 for Wooden Pallets Online pallets).

Expense: New pallets can differ substantially in cost; it's vital to evaluate your budget plan while ensuring quality.

How do I know what size pallet I need?
Answer: The size of the pallet depends upon your product dimensions and storage areas. Standard sizes are commonly offered, but it's best to measure your products and storage area first.
2. What is the average life-span of a wooden pallet?
Answer: Wooden Shipping Pallets pallets can last anywhere from 4-8 years if effectively maintained, while new pallets developed for multiple usages can last even longer.
3. Can I purchase customized pallets?
Answer: Yes, numerous suppliers use the choice to design custom-made pallets. It's recommended to discuss your particular requirements with your supplier.
4. Are plastic pallets worth the financial investment?
Answer: Yes, while at first more expensive, plastic pallets use resilience, easier maintenance, and potential savings in the long run due to lower replacement costs.
